Peavey RQ 4300 Series Music Mixer User Manual


 
STANDARD CHANNELS
[CHANNELS 1 — 20 (RQ 4324) AND 1 — 28 (RQ 4332)]
REAR PANEL CONNECTIONS (1) INSERT
This jack is a 1/4" Tip/Ring/Sleeve (TRS)
connection that allows a pre-EQ, pre-fader
signal to be taken from and returned to the
channel. Insert jacks are often used to route
an input signal to an external signal processor.
The RQ 4300’s on-board compressors can
be patched to any channel with an INSERT.
(2) LINE
This jack is a 1/4" balanced (TRS) high
impedance input for high level signals. The tip
is the positive input, which should also be
used for unbalanced inputs. This input is
connected through a 20 dB pad to the MIC
input (3). The two inputs cannot be used
simultaneously.
(3) MIC
This jack is a balanced XLR (3-pin) low-
impedance connection intended for
microphones. Other low-impedance signals
such as instruments sent to the console via
direct boxes will also utilize these inputs.
CHANNEL STRIP CONTROLS
(4) GAIN
This control varies the input gain of the channel to provide a wider dynamic range. The
adjustment range is +10 dB to +58 dB for the XLR input and –10 dB to +38 dB for the line
input. Proper adjustment of input gain maximizes signal-to-noise ratio. Optimum gain setting
can be achieved by depressing the PFL switch (15) and adjusting the GAIN control until the
signal occasionally illuminates the 0 dB LED in the AFL/PFL display (45).
(5) LOW CUT
This control adjusts the setting of the low-cut filter. Variable from no cut to cut below 300 Hz,
this feature reduces/eliminates extremely low frequencies that cause “low-end rumble,” and is
a very effective tone shaping tool. It can also be used to reduce the “boominess” sometimes
encountered with male voices.
(6) HI
This active tone control is a shelving-type that varies high-frequency response by +/-15 dB in
the range above 12 kHz.
(7) MID
This active tone control is a bandpass (peak/notch) type that varies mid-frequency response
by +/-15 dB in a range from 200 Hz to 6 kHz.
